Crime Data in Kanata

Crime Perception and Concerns

In 2024, Kanata's crime data reveals moderate concerns among residents, with certain areas requiring attention to reduce crime rates. The overall safety perception is mixed, affecting how people view their general security, especially at nighttime.

While residents feel relatively safe during the day, there is a notable concern about safety when alone at night, indicating opportunities for enhancing community security.

Some notable concerns include:
  • Property CrimesProperty crimes remain a mild concern in Kanata, with issues such as home break-ins and car theft still present but not overwhelming. Residents regard these issues as manageable but worth addressing to maintain community trust.
  • Drug-Related IssuesThe perception of drug-related problems is a significant concern, with residents feeling the impact of drug activity on the community's sense of well-being. This highlights a critical area for law enforcement and community initiatives.
  • Violent CrimesConcerns about violent crimes are relatively low, with fears about robbery and physical assaults being less prominent. However, maintaining vigilance is crucial to prevent any potential increase.
  • Public SafetyKanata residents generally feel safer during the daylight, enjoying a supportive community atmosphere. Despite this, there is a pressing need to address concerns over nighttime safety to enhance overall security.
Crime Trends and Safety
  • Rising Crime ConcernsThe feeling that crime levels are rising is quite pronounced among residents, particularly in relation to property and drug-related issues. This perception emphasizes the need for proactive safety measures.
  • Specific FearsSpecific fears in Kanata focus mainly on drug-related offenses, with some anxiety around theft. Despite the low levels of racial or ethnic tensions, there exists an undercurrent of concern that needs addressing through comprehensive community strategies.

Pollution Data in Kanata

Air Quality and Pollution Levels

Kanata continues to impress with its exceptional air quality, setting a high standard for environmental health in urban areas. The city's commitment to maintaining clear skies and clean air is evident through low levels of pollution.

Residents experience excellent air quality with little to no pollution from particulate matter, ensuring a healthy environment for living and outdoor activities.

  • PM2.5 (Fine Particulate Matter)PM2.5 levels in Kanata are practically nonexistent, representing a model for cities striving for cleaner air. This contributes significantly to the overall health and wellness of the population.
  • PM10 (Coarse Particulate Matter)Similarly, PM10 levels are negligible, ensuring the air is clean and safe to breathe for all, particularly beneficial for sensitive demographics.
Waste and Noise Pollution

Despite Kanata's strengths in air quality, noise pollution poses challenges, mainly from urban development activities. This affects the otherwise calm environment, requiring effective noise management strategies.

Garbage disposal services in Kanata meet public expectations, with high satisfaction levels indicating efficient waste management practices in place.

  • Garbage Disposal SatisfactionResidents express satisfaction with garbage disposal services, noting that the city manages waste efficiently, contributing to the overall cleanliness and tidiness of the community.
  • Noise and Light PollutionNoise pollution is notably problematic, primarily due to ongoing construction and urbanization efforts. Addressing these concerns can greatly improve the quality of life in Kanata's bustling areas.
Green Spaces and Water Quality

Kanata boasts outstanding green spaces, providing essential recreational and environmental benefits. These areas are cherished by residents for their accessibility and upkeep, enhancing livability.

The city’s drinking water quality is exemplary, offering residents peace of mind with reliable and safe water access.

  • Green and Parks QualityGreen spaces in Kanata are maintained to an excellent standard, providing a serene escape from urban life. These parks are integral to the community’s well-being and environmental health.
  • Drinking Water QualityKanata residents greatly appreciate the quality of drinking water, which is consistently clean and accessible, greatly enhancing the city's livability.

Pollution Rankings

The pollution ranking for Canada is based on a combination of visitor perceptions and data from institutions like the World Health Organization. The Pollution Index estimates overall pollution levels by considering air and water pollution, garbage disposal, and other factors, with air pollution given the highest weight, while the Pollution Exp Scale uses an exponential function to highlight extremely polluted cities.
